Live score updates from Wests Tigers' Round 4 clash against the Canterbury-Bankstown Bulldogs — played at ANZ Stadium on Friday, March 27.

1'— Bulldogs kickoff to start the match.

5'— TRY TIME! Kyle Lovett gets his first try in the NRL after running a well-timed line and receiving a short pass from Luke Brooks on the right edge!

6'— Mitch Moses converts. Wests Tigers lead 6-0.

16'— Bulldogs try. Frank Pritchard offloads close to the ground for Curtis Rona, who puts the ball down in the corner. It's checked upstairs but the green light is given.

18'— Trent Hodkinson converts. Scores locked up at 6-6.

24'— NO TRY: James Tedesco goes very close to scoring in the corner, but it's ruled no try after Trent Hodkinson goes down under minimal contact from Simona. Obstruction called.

40'— HALF TIME: Wests Tigers 6-6 Canterbury-Bankstown Bulldogs.

45'— ON REPORT: Chris Lawrence is placed on report for a mid-air collision with Sam Perrett.

46'— TRY TIME! Greg Eastwood tries to grubber it through the line, bounces into Brooks' legs, who picks it up and races 70m to score next to the posts!

47'— Moses converts. Wests Tigers lead 12-6.

49'— TRY TIME! Curtis Sironen finds Brooks with a great offload, who races upfield before grubbering through the line with a banana kick grubber for Tedesco to score!

50'— Moses converts. Wests Tigers lead 18-6.

56'— TRY TIME! Brooks grubbers back across his body and finds a flying Tedesco for the try!

57'— Moses converts. Wests Tigers lead 24-6.

59'— Bulldogs try. Michael Lichaa steps under a tackle from Brenden Santi close to the line and dives over. Hodkinson converts from next to the posts. Wests Tigers lead 24-12.

62'— Crowd announced as 20,121.

68'— Bulldogs try. Sam Kasiano throws a cut-out ball for Rona to score in the corner.

69'— Hodkinson converts from the sideline. Wests Tigers lead 24-18.

75'— Luke Brooks missed field goal.

76'— Bulldogs try. Rona offloads and finds Morris, who scores out wide.

77'— Hodkinson converts. Score tied at 24-all.

80'— Wests Tigers 24 tied with Bulldogs 24. Golden Point.

82'— Moses taken out after kicking, 30m in front. No penalty. Bulldogs on the attack.

83'— Hodkinson missed field goal, 20m out right in front.

83'— Brooks missed field goal, 40m out.

84'— Mbye field goal, 30m out. Bulldogs lead 25-24.

84'— FULL TIME: Canterbury-Bankstown Bulldogs 25 def. Wests Tigers 24
